picturesque village of Beetham is located within the Silverdale and Arnside
designated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ty and located only fifteen minutes
from the Lake District with excellent transport links close by. Beetham itself
boasts the fantastic Beetham Nurseries offering a range of gifts, plants and a
popular café, the Wheatsheaf pub, the Heron Theatre, Heron Corn Mill that
hosts a range of different craft activities, the Tea Rooms and village shop
and lots more. There are relaxing and exhilarating walks on the doorstep to
enjoy with 'The Fairy Steps' and Dallam Deer Park to name but a couple. Just
one mile away in the village of Milnthorpe there is a wide array of social
activities offered for all ages including sports clubs, choirs and yoga
classes. There is a Booths supermarket, 2 pubs, a Spar and petrol station, 2
doctors surgeries, 2 dentists, a vets, several independent shops and a variety
of eateries available
